    I had JPX 921 HMP. I'm a 4 HDCP, and didn't realize how strongly lofted the HMP were. I was carrying my P wedge 145 and had a large yard gap between 50 degree and P wedge. I met with a club pro. Tried out a more traditional style of irons. I still wanted some forgiveness, but wanted some of the aspects of a players iron. I traded in my JPX 921s HMP and left with a P-4 Iron Wilson Staff model CBs. The lofts are more traditional with 7 iron at 34 degrees and now I carry my P wedge 135 and I can easily hit it 125 if needed. Now my gaps are closed and playing well. Love these irons. If your a decent ball striker, the other benefit of these clubs, is the ability to club up and swing confidently. With the strong lofted clubs and hot face, I could randomly get a ball that would just come off sooooo hot and fly 10 yards further than expected. These clubs have me dialed in with my carry numbers.

    Hey James, the reason that you are not getting the longer distance is because the Lofts are weaker. The Wilson Staff Blade & CB 7 Iron is 34 Degrees. Most 7 Irons are 30 to 32 Degrees. It is more like an 8 Iron.
